Another Kleven OCV for Rem Offshore

Importer
Kleven is to build another MT6022 construction vessel for Rem Offshore

The ship will be to the Marin Teknikk MT6022 design, and at 108m long and 22m wide, with accommodation for 110 personnel, it will be one of the largest offshore support vessels built at the Kleven yard in Ulsteinvik. Among the features will be an offshore crane able to lift 250tonnes at 650m or 135tonnes at 3,000m water depth.

“Kleven Maritime and Rem have had a strong relationship for many years, and we are very pleased that they choose Kleven again,” said Ståle Rasmussen, CEO of Kleven Maritime. Kleven has so far delivered 12 vessels to Rem, and will deliver a LNG powered vessel to Rem in December this year.

“We believe the market for this type of vessels will be strong in the future,” said ship owner Åge Remøy of Rem Offshore. “We took delivery of a vessel of the same type from Kleven yard in August 2008, and our experience with this vessel, Rem Forza, is very positive.”
